阅读:1420回复:5
有什么方法可以区分打印机的连接类型:本地、网络、网络邻居?
谢谢了!
|
|
|
沙发#
发布于:2004-09-09 13:00
可以得到打印机的属性,就知道是什么打印机了
如: PRINTER_ENUM_LOCAL PRINTER_ENUM_SHARED PRINTER_ENUM_CONNECTIONS PRINTER_ENUM_NETWORK PRINTER_ENUM_REMOTE |
|
|
板凳#
发布于:2004-09-10 09:08
谢谢snowStart!
还有一个问题,我通过StartDocPrinter获得的打印Job信息(PDOC_INFO_1)总是不完整,有没有办法可以获得打印文档比较详细、准确的信息? |
|
|
地板#
发布于:2004-09-10 12:58
那你用GetJob()吧
|
|
|
地下室#
发布于:2004-09-10 13:25
打印Job的信息已经搞定了,开始的原因是StartDocW的参数分析没能正确处理Unicode的问题,折腾了一个上午。
请教SnowStart:我已经有打印机的句柄了,如何得到你所说打印机的属性信息,谢谢! |
|
|
5楼#
发布于:2004-09-10 14:07
用GetPrinter搞定了。
|
|
|